Abstract
Objective:To evaluate the application of 3D DSA in the diagnosis of intracranial aneurysms.in comparision with conventional DSA.Methods:15 patients with subarachnoid hemorrhage(SAH),who were admitted to our hospital within 3 days,were all subjected to routine DSA/3D DSA inspection and the different methods for showing aneurysm diseases were analzed in this work.Results:In the 15 patients,moyamoya disease was found in 1 case and aneurysm in 10 cases.8 cases were detected by conventional DSA,which demonstrated only a very small number of aneurysm neck morphology(2 / 8) and parent artery and the relationship between tumors(1 / 8).On the contrary,3D DSA significantly improved the ability to display the complex structure compared with conventional DSA.3D DSA images could clearly show the aneurysm tumor,aneurysm neck morphology and relationship between parent arteries in 10 cases.3D DSA confirmed that the false-positive blood vessels in patients as shown by conventional DSA were attributable to the vessel distortion.Conclusion:3D DSA can offer the three-dimensional and visual indications of intracranial aneurysms and the relation to anatomy,thereby providing valuable imaging information for the surgical clipping and intervention treatment of the disorders.
